What Are the 8 Dimensions of Wellness?
The 8 Dimensions of Wellness is a model that recognizes various interconnected aspects of well-being. It provides a comprehensive framework to assess and improve your overall quality of life. Each dimension represents a different facet of your well-being and contributes to your overall health and happiness. Here are the 8 dimensions:
Physical Wellness: This dimension encompasses your body's health, fitness, and the ability to maintain a healthy lifestyle. It involves regular exercise, a balanced diet, and taking measures to prevent illness and injury.
Emotional Wellness: Emotional wellness focuses on recognizing, understanding, and effectively managing your emotions. It's about developing resilience, emotional intelligence, and coping strategies to handle life's challenges.
Social Wellness: Social wellness emphasizes the importance of building and maintaining healthy relationships. It involves effective communication, a strong support system, and a sense of belonging.
Intellectual Wellness: Intellectual wellness revolves around lifelong learning, creativity, and mental stimulation. It encourages you to expand your knowledge and skills, foster curiosity, and engage in critical thinking.
Occupational Wellness: Occupational wellness involves finding satisfaction and balance in your work or daily activities. It encourages a harmonious work-life balance, career development, and a sense of purpose in your professional life.
Environmental Wellness: Environmental wellness is all about your relationship with your surroundings. It emphasizes respect for the environment, sustainability, and making choices that minimize harm to the planet.
Spiritual Wellness: Spiritual wellness doesn't necessarily pertain to religion. It's about finding a sense of purpose, meaning, and inner peace in your life. It encourages self-reflection and the exploration of your values and beliefs.
Financial Wellness: Financial wellness focuses on your financial health and security. It involves responsible money management, budgeting, and planning for your future.
The Health and Wellness Benefits of Balancing the 8 Dimensions
Now that we've outlined the 8 Dimensions of Wellness, let's explore the remarkable health and wellness benefits associated with embracing each dimension:
1. Physical Wellness
Enhanced Physical Health: By maintaining a regular exercise routine and adopting a balanced diet, you can reduce the risk of chronic diseases like heart disease and diabetes. Physical wellness also promotes better immune system function, leading to overall improved health (Mayo Clinic).
Increased Energy Levels: Regular physical activity boosts your energy levels, making you more alert and productive in your daily life.
Improved Mental Health: Exercise releases endorphins, the body's natural mood lifters, which can reduce symptoms of anxiety and depression (Harvard Health Publishing).
2. Emotional Wellness
Reduced Stress: Developing emotional intelligence and coping strategies can help you manage stress effectively, preventing the adverse health effects associated with chronic stress (American Psychological Association).
Enhanced Resilience: Emotional wellness builds resilience, enabling you to bounce back from setbacks and challenges.
Improved Relationships: Understanding and managing your emotions can lead to better communication and more harmonious relationships with others.
3. Social Wellness
Increased Happiness: Strong social connections and a sense of belonging are linked to higher levels of happiness and life satisfaction (Psychological Science).
Longer Life: Studies have shown that people with robust social networks tend to live longer and have better health outcomes (Harvard Health Publishing).
Mental Health Benefits: Social support plays a crucial role in preventing mental health issues and aiding in recovery when they occur (Mental Health America).
4. Intellectual Wellness
Cognitive Health: Lifelong learning and mental stimulation are associated with improved cognitive function and a reduced risk of cognitive decline in later life (Alzheimer's Association).
Problem-Solving Skills: Intellectual wellness enhances your ability to solve problems, make informed decisions, and adapt to new situations.
Enhanced Creativity: Engaging in intellectually stimulating activities can boost your creative thinking and problem-solving skills.
5. Occupational Wellness
Higher Job Satisfaction: Achieving a sense of purpose and balance in your work life contributes to higher job satisfaction and overall well-being.
Reduced Stress at Work: Balancing your professional and personal life can lead to decreased stress and burnout in the workplace (American Psychological Association).
Improved Career Growth: By focusing on occupational wellness, you can set and achieve career goals, leading to professional growth and development.
6. Environmental Wellness
Healthier Living Environment: Making environmentally responsible choices can lead to a healthier living space and a reduced risk of exposure to toxins.
Contribution to Sustainability: Environmental wellness encourages practices that contribute to global sustainability, helping to protect natural resources for future generations.
Positive Mental Impact: Caring for the environment can promote a sense of purpose and reduce eco-anxiety, leading to better mental health (American Psychological Association).
Spiritual Wellness
Inner Peace: Spiritual wellness helps you find a sense of inner peace and tranquility, reducing stress and promoting mental well-being.
Enhanced Resilience: A strong sense of purpose can help you navigate life's challenges with greater resilience and optimism.
Improved Emotional Regulation: Spiritual practices often involve mindfulness and self-reflection, which can lead to better emotional regulation and mental health (Frontiers in Psychiatry).
8. Financial Wellness
Reduced Financial Stress: Effective money management and financial planning can significantly reduce stress, improve mental health, and enhance overall well-being (American Psychological Association).
Financial Security: Achieving financial wellness provides a sense of security and the ability to plan for the future, reducing anxiety about financial uncertainty.
Improved Quality of Life: Financial wellness can lead to a higher quality of life, with the ability to pursue goals and experiences that bring happiness and fulfillment.
